The teaching officially starts on 31 Aug 2026, but we highly recommend you take part in the orientation activities for the new students that take place the week before, starting as of 24 Aug 2026.
You will be assigned to a tutor group led by a senior student who will be your student tutor. Tutors will help with questions related to studying on our programme, give support with administrative matters and introduce you to the university campuses and facilities. This will make it easier for you to start your studies and life in Helsinki. Each student can choose a teacher tutor with whom you can discuss your personal study plan and goals.
The detailed information and schedule concerning your orientation and tutoring will be published in the Instructions for students in the summer.

The international students in the Master's Programme in MMB can apply to the UNITalent Programme. It is designed to support international students in building professional networks in Finland and to gain insight into field specific working life. Students take part by attending monthly group meetings with hosting organisation for a period of three months. During the programme, the University Career Services also provides training in career management skills. The continuation of the programme will be decided in spring 2026.
